Managing Dietary Logistics at Scale

When you are hosting hundreds of guests, managing dietary restrictions becomes a major logistical exercise. It is no longer just about a single vegetarian option; you must account for a wide range of allergies, religious dietary laws, and lifestyle choices. A professional kitchen team will be able to manage these variations without slowing down the service. By clearly communicating these needs to your provider well in advance, you can ensure that every guest, regardless of their restrictions, receives a meal of the same high quality and presentation as the standard menu.

Coordinating Service with the Event Schedule

A gala event usually features a tight schedule of speeches, performances, and perhaps a silent auction. The meal service must be carefully choreographed to complement this timeline rather than interrupt it. Waitstaff must be trained to move through the room with speed and discretion, clearing plates and refilling drinks without drawing attention away from the stage. This level of coordination requires an experienced team that understands the rhythm of high-stakes functions. When the service and the programme are perfectly aligned, the evening feels effortless and polished to every attendee in the room.
